Once upon a time, on a bright and sunny morning, Cyrus woke up with an unusual sparkle in his eyes. Today wasn’t just any day. Today was the day he would embark on an extraordinary adventure, one that would take him to the heart of Disneyland, to the legendary Glowstone Caverns.

Cyrus, with his wild curly hair and boundless energy, was no ordinary boy. He had a heart full of courage and a mind brimming with curiosity. Dressed in his favorite adventure gear, he held tightly to his magical lantern, a gift from his grandmother Lumi. The lantern wasn’t just for light; it was the key to unlocking the wonders of the Glowstone Caverns.

As Cyrus stepped into Disneyland, the air buzzed with magic. The colors seemed brighter, the sounds more melodious. It was as if the very ground he walked on knew he was destined for an adventure. His first encounter was with none other than Winnie-the-Pooh, who, with his gentle smile and warm hug, whispered, “The Glowstone Caverns are waiting for you, Cyrus. Follow the lantern’s glow.”

With a nod and a smile, Cyrus ventured forth, his lantern beginning to glow with a soft, pulsing light. The path led him through an enchanted forest, where trees whispered secrets and shadows danced. Cyrus wasn’t afraid. The lantern’s glow painted the world in a soft, reassuring light.

Deeper into the forest, Cyrus stumbled upon a stream shimmering with fish that sparkled like jewels. “Follow the stream, and you’ll find your way,” murmured the water as it flowed. Cyrus walked alongside it, marveling at the beauty around him. The stream led to a hidden passage, covered in vines that parted at the touch of the lantern’s light.

The passage was dark, but Cyrus forged ahead, his heart beating with excitement. After what felt like an eternity, the tunnel opened up into the Glowstone Caverns. Cyrus gasped in awe. The caverns were alive with glowing mushrooms, shimmering crystals, and stones that lit up like stars in the night sky. The caverns breathed with an ancient magic, and Cyrus felt as though he had stepped into another world.

As he explored, he encountered creatures of light, beings that shimmered and glided through the air. They were guardians of the caverns, and they watched Cyrus with curious eyes. “To truly understand the magic of the Glowstone Caverns, you must share your light with others,” whispered one of the creatures, its voice like the chime of a bell.

Cyrus remembered the extra glowstones his grandmother had given him, each one imbued with the magic of the lantern. With a generous heart, he began placing glowstones throughout the caverns, in dark corners and hidden nooks. With each stone he placed, the caverns grew brighter, and the creatures danced with joy.

As the last glowstone was placed, the caverns erupted in a dazzling display of light, brighter than the sun itself. Cyrus watched in wonder as the magic he had shared filled the caverns with warmth and light. In that moment, he realized the true lesson of his adventure: that sharing your light with the world makes it a brighter place for everyone.

With his mission complete, Cyrus followed the bright path back through the tunnel, past the stream, and out of the enchanted forest. Winnie-the-Pooh was waiting for him, a proud smile on his face. “Well done, Cyrus. You’ve not only discovered the magic of the Glowstone Caverns but the magic within yourself.”

As the sun began to set, casting a golden glow over Disneyland, Cyrus knew that this adventure would stay with him forever. He had journeyed to a place few had ever seen and had come back with the greatest treasure of all: the knowledge that kindness and generosity are the most powerful magics of all.

And so, with his magical lantern by his side and his heart full of new stories to tell, Cyrus drifted off to sleep, dreaming of the next great adventure that awaited him in the wonderful, magical world of Disneyland.

The end.
